I managed to get permission on a farm that has a roman road, and a drovers road running right through it. there is also, very close, a medieval nunnery, that is said to be the oldest in Wales. so it looks promising, I researched it and found that all the valuables from the church were buried in secret (even the stained glass window from the church, which was later recovered and re-fitted).
We went there on sunday, and searched around the first field, which, on the 1829 OS MAP showed the original farm house (now totally gone), but could'nt find much in the way of old house fitments as I expected, but I did find one of the old dumps in a dingle to the side, which was crammed with broken pottery and glass bottles (all victorian and edwardian) The F75 was skipping all over the place, but it was mainly the bottle tops and tins.
We had a look around the farm garden, and found a corroded bent ring shaped piece, didn't think much of it at the time, but when cleaned up later, found it to be copper/bronze, and guess it to be a roman ring.
